Pseudorandom number generator based on novel 2D Henon-Sine hyperchaotic map with microcontroller implementation

被引:47
|
作者
Murillo-Escobar, Daniel [1 ]
Angel Murillo-Escobar, Miguel [1 ]
Cruz-Hernandez, Cesar [3 ]
Arellano-Delgado, Adrian [2 ]
Martha Lopez-Gutierrez, Rosa [1 ]
机构
[1] Autonomous Univ Baja California UABC, Engn Architecture & Design Fac, Ensenada, Baja California, Mexico
[2] CONACYT UABC Autonomous Univ Baja California UABC, Engn Architecture & Design Fac, Ensenada, Baja California, Mexico
[3] Sci Res & Adv Studies Ctr Ensenada CICESE, Elect & Telecommun Dept, Ensenada, Baja California, Mexico
关键词
Chaos; Pseudorandom number generator; 2D Henon-Sine hyperchaotic map; Microcontroller implementation; Security analysis; ENCRYPTION SCHEME; CHAOS; ALGORITHM; PRNG;
D O I
10.1007/s11071-022-08101-2
中图分类号
TH [机械、仪表工业];
学科分类号
0802 ;
摘要
Recently, chaotic maps have been considered to design pseudorandom number generator (PRNG). However, some chaotic maps present security disadvantages, such as low uniformity and low randomness properties. Nowadays, chaos-based PRNGs are used as the main source for the development of cryptographic algorithms. In this work, to overcome such weaknesses, a novel 2D hyperchaotic map is proposed based on discrete-time feedback by using Henon map and Sine map. In addition, the dynamics of the hyperchaotic map are enhanced by using the remainder after division function (rem), where better random statistical properties are obtained. A comparison is made between the enhanced Henon-Sine hyperchaotic map (EHSHM) and the Henon-Sine hyperchaotic map through Lyapunov exponent analysis, attractor trajectory, histograms and sensitivity at initialization. Then, 8-bit pseudorandom number generator based on the proposed hyperchaotic map (PRNG-EHSHM) is designed and the initial seed of the PRNG is calculated by a secret key of 60 hexadecimal characters. It is implemented in both MATLAB and Arduino Mega microcontroller for experimental results. A complete security analysis is presented from a cryptographic point of view, such as key space, floating frequency, histograms and entropy of the information. Moreover, the randomness is verified with the tests of the National Institute of Standards and Technology (NIST 800-22). Based on the security results obtained, the proposed PRNG-EHSHM can be implemented in embedded cryptographic applications based on chaos.
引用
收藏
页码:6773 / 6789
页数:17
相关论文
共 46 条
  • [31] Medical video encryption using novel 2D Cosine-Sine map and dynamic DNA coding
    Dhingra, Deepti
    Dua, Mohit
    MEDICAL & BIOLOGICAL ENGINEERING & COMPUTING, 2024, 62 (01) : 237 - 255
  • [32] A novel color image encryption based on fractional shifted Gegenbauer moments and 2D logistic-sine map
    Hosny, Khalid M.
    Kamal, Sara T.
    Darwish, Mohamed M.
    VISUAL COMPUTER, 2023, 39 (03) : 1027 - 1044
  • [33] A novel bit-level image encryption algorithm based on 2D-LICM hyperchaotic map
    Cao, Chun
    Sun, Kehui
    Liu, Wenhao
    SIGNAL PROCESSING, 2018, 143 : 122 - 133
  • [34] An image encryption method based on multi-space confusion using hyperchaotic 2D Vincent map derived from optimization benchmark function
    Erkan, Ugur
    Toktas, Abdurrahim
    Memis, Samet
    Lai, Qiang
    Hu, Genwen
    NONLINEAR DYNAMICS, 2023, 111 (21) : 20377 - 20405
  • [35] Novel encryption method for color images based on cross-channel substitution and permutation using an improved two-dimensional Henon map (2D IHM)
    Asha J. Vithayathil
    A. Sreekumar
    Nonlinear Dynamics, 2025, 113 (8) : 9081 - 9109
  • [36] Quantum image encryption scheme based on 2D Sine2 - Logistic chaotic map
    Hu, Miaoting
    Li, Jinqing
    Di, Xiaoqiang
    NONLINEAR DYNAMICS, 2023, 111 (03) : 2815 - 2839
  • [37] Cryptanalysis and Improvement of the Image Encryption Scheme Based on 2D Logistic-Adjusted-Sine Map
    Feng, Wei
    He, Yigang
    Li, Hongmin
    Li, Chunlai
    IEEE ACCESS, 2019, 7 : 12584 - 12597
  • [38] A Selective Image Encryption Scheme Based on 2D DWT, Henon Map and 4D Qi Hyper-Chaos
    Tresor, Lisungu Oteko
    Sumbwanyambe, Mbuyu
    IEEE ACCESS, 2019, 7 : 103463 - 103472
  • [39] A secure image encryption scheme based on a novel 2D sine-cosine cross-chaotic (SC3) map
    Mondal, Bhaskar
    Behera, Pratap Kumar
    Gangopadhyay, Sugata
    JOURNAL OF REAL-TIME IMAGE PROCESSING, 2021, 18 (01) : 1 - 18
  • [40] An image encryption method based on multi-space confusion using hyperchaotic 2D Vincent map derived from optimization benchmark function
    Uğur Erkan
    Abdurrahim Toktas
    Samet Memiş
    Qiang Lai
    Genwen Hu
    Nonlinear Dynamics, 2023, 111 : 20377 - 20405